Sofía Margarita Vergara Vergara is a distinguished Colombian-American actress and television personality who has made significant contributions to the entertainment industry. She gained widespread fame for her portrayal of the vivacious and endearing Gloria Delgado-Pritchett on the acclaimed ABC sitcom “Modern Family.” Her compelling performance on the show endeared her to audiences worldwide and earned her critical acclaim. Additionally, Vergara took on a dramatically different role as the notorious drug lord Griselda Blanco in the gripping miniseries “Griselda,” showcasing her versatility as an actress.

Vergara’s journey to stardom began in the late 1990s when she co-hosted two popular television shows on the Spanish-language network Univision. Her charisma and talent quickly made her a household name in the Latin American community. However, it was her transition to English-language roles that truly catapulted her into international stardom. Her first significant English-speaking role came in the 2003 romantic comedy “Chasing Papi,” where her performance garnered attention and opened doors to more prominent roles in Hollywood.
